%description
|
|
This module in an fully object-oriented implementation of a simple n-ary
|
|
tree. It is built upon the concept of parent-child relationships, so
|
|
therefore every *Tree::Simple* object has both a parent and a set of
|
|
children (who themselves may have children, and so on). Every
|
|
*Tree::Simple* object also has siblings, as they are just the children of
|
|
their immediate parent.
|
|
|
|
It is can be used to model hierarchal information such as a file-system,
|
|
the organizational structure of a company, an object inheritance hierarchy,
|
|
versioned files from a version control system or even an abstract syntax
|
|
tree for use in a parser. It makes no assumptions as to your intended
|
|
usage, but instead simply provides the structure and means of accessing and
|
|
traversing said structure.
|
|
|
|
This module uses exceptions and a minimal Design By Contract style. All
|
|
method arguments are required unless specified in the documentation, if a
|
|
required argument is not defined an exception will usually be thrown. Many
|
|
arguments are also required to be of a specific type, for instance the
|
|
'$parent' argument to the constructor *must* be a *Tree::Simple* object or
|
|
an object derived from *Tree::Simple*, otherwise an exception is thrown.
|
|
This may seems harsh to some, but this allows me to have the confidence
|
|
that my code works as I intend, and for you to enjoy the same level of
|
|
confidence when using this module. Note however that this module does not
|
|
use any Exception or Error module, the exceptions are just strings thrown
|
|
with 'die'.
